As you can probably see in the attached pictures, its just a hamster bottle and a vinyl tube to replace the metal one. i split the end of the tube that is in the bottle beceause i was getting issues with bubbles getting trapped in the round tube. that wouldnt be a problem with a larger size tube or bottle. the tube is mounted submerged just below the water line so that when the water level drops the water spills from the tube and into the tank. its similar to the way when you put your finger over the end of a straw the water is held inside. thats where the inspiration came from....
the hardest part of building one is making sure the bottle is airtight, if air gets in a vacuum cant be created and the contents will simply spill into the tank. it doesnt even have to be a bottle, a hole drilled into any other airtight contsainer would work just as well. the bottle should also be built of a rigid material, mine is glass but rigid plastic will do as well. but once its together and working, it CANT fail, no moving parts, just physics doing the heavy lifting for you
